JD.com, Inc. (NASDAQ:JD) Shares Sold by Renaissance Technologies LLC

Renaissance Technologies LLC trimmed its position in JD.com, Inc. (NASDAQ:JDFree Report) by 16.3% during the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 749,778 shares of the information services provider’s stock after selling 145,922 shares during the period. Renaissance Technologies LLC’s holdings in JD.com were worth $19,374,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

JD.com Profile

(Free Report)

JD.com, Inc operates as a supply chain-based technology and service provider in the People's Republic of China. The company offers computers, communication, and consumer electronics products, as well as home appliances; and general merchandise products comprising food, beverage and fresh produce, baby and maternity products, furniture and household goods, cosmetics and other personal care items, pharmaceutical and healthcare products, industrial products, books, automobile accessories, apparel and footwear, bags, and jewelry.
